Gas Type G31
This section details the differences between Natural
Gas and Propane models.
Propane firefronts are only suitable for use with
Bermuda 553 Propane Back Boiler appliances. The
instructions supplied with the back boiler contain details
of gas supply requirements and electrical connections.
All site requirements and installation details can be
found earlier in this booklet.

Pilot Shield Brackets
Before fitting the outercase it is essential to fit the pilot
shield brackets provided in the installation kit. The
brackets fit to the rear of the lower front panel and are
secured using the No.8 x
3
/
8
self tapping screws supplied
(See diagram).
Propane appliances can be converted to operate on
Natural Gas if required.
A conversion kit is available, Baxi Part No 247064.
